"Gills Just Wanna Have Fun" is the 15th episode of Season 2. Daffney's favorite icon, Jane Flounder, comes to town, and so she does everything to look just like her. Meanwhile, Dr. Strangesnork tries stealing the red beam he wants to use to take over town, but it's in Daffney's hair.

Plot Summary
[]

Dr. Strangesnork is in town, and he intends on using his Permanent Wave Machine to flatten Snorkland and turn it into his own images, even with street signs all named after him. In the meantime, Gallio and the snorks are doing some spring cleaning inside his lab. Daffney shows up late, only because she's trying her best to be like Jane Flounder, her current favorite icon. She then comments on how she has style compared to her friends, and that they dress boring. As this goes on. the machine causes waves to be made, thus making the lab dirtier than before.

Within that mess, Daffney finds the red power pearl, and decides to keep it as a hair ornament resembling the one Jane Flounder already has in her hair. However, Dr. Strangesnork wants to use that same power pearl for his machine so that it would be more productive in flattening Snorkland. He happens to spot her wearing it, so he follows her into a health and fitness club, although he gets thrown out for not being a girl. He then decides to disguise himself as one and try to steal the pearl from Daffney when she's not looking. However, the head of the club catches him each time, so she makes him walk twenty miles on the treadmill as well as attach him to a slingshot. 

Bruno, the other head of the club, then tells Daffney that Jane Flounder will be coming to the Neptune Vitamin Shop that same afternoon where she will be signing "watergraphs." Considering Daffney wants to dress exactly like her for the occasion, she goes to the hair salon to get her hair and style done. Dr. Strangesnork disguises himself as a hair stylist, only to get busted by that same lady once more for messing up her hair. He then decides to disguise himself as Jane when she comes by. At that moment, Daffney sees all the other female snorks dressed just like her, making her feel less unique. She ditches the outfit and the pearl, telling her friends if she wants to be different, she needs to be herself. Dr. Strangesnork ends up getting the pearl and using it for the machine, but it goes haywire. He then remembers that Gallio only threw it out because it has caused all machines to short circuit.

Allusions[]

  • The title is a reference to Cyndi Lauper's hit 80's single "Girls Just Wanna Have Fun"
  • Jane Flounder parodies Jane Fonda, who was well-known for being a strong feminist at the time this cartoon was made
